Cost effective cooking

We made a large batch of chilli minced beef and froze some portions. This has helped us out at times like this, when we've been away and haven't cooked/shopped. It's also very cost effective.
Tonight we had our chilli and jacket potato. This came to around 600 calories and was very filling and delicious.
We have found that if we don't eat enough, we are more likely to snack.
On our 'good' days (Monday to Thursday) we still get to eat quite a few calories (I have 1500 and my partner has 2000). It's amazing what you can do with that many calories if you put your mind to it. We generally like to keep a few back for a snack, so we don't miss out on anything.
